            Your nephew don't have to do National Service? His decision will be affected by when he enrols & finishes his NS.

            For entry to Poly, you may want to call the Poly directly. According to TP Admission website, for those with A leevl result, it is written \"Holders of Singapore-Cambridge GCE A Levels (Applicants will use Singapore-Cambridge GCE O Levels as Entry Qualifications)\"
            (http://www.tp.edu.sg/home/admissions/adm_exercise/dae_intake_apr.htm)

            Qns: Can my nephew repeat his A-level in his JC if he has a full A-level cert?
            Ans: I believe the answer is NO. Check with the JC when he collected his result.

            Private Institution : Ask your nephew what programmes he wants to do in the University. Different Private Institutions have programmes from different universities. Somes are good in one area, but others are good in another.
